[PATCH v2 23/30] bsd-user/arm/target_arch_signal.h: arm get_mcontext


From: Warner Losh
Subject: [PATCH v2 23/30] bsd-user/arm/target_arch_signal.h: arm get_mcontext
Date: Tue, 2 Nov 2021 16:52:41 -0600

Get the machine context from the CPU state.

+/*
+ * Compare to arm/arm/machdep.c get_mcontext()
+ * Assumes that the memory is locked if mcp points to user memory.
+ */
+static inline abi_long get_mcontext(CPUARMState *env, target_mcontext_t *mcp,
+        int flags)
+{
+    int err = 0;
+    uint32_t *gr = mcp->__gregs;
+
+    if (mcp->mc_vfp_size != 0 && mcp->mc_vfp_size != 
sizeof(target_mcontext_vfp_t)) {
+        return -TARGET_EINVAL;
+    }
+
+    gr[TARGET_REG_CPSR] = tswap32(cpsr_read(env));
+    if (flags & TARGET_MC_GET_CLEAR_RET) {
+        gr[TARGET_REG_R0] = 0;
+        gr[TARGET_REG_CPSR] &= ~CPSR_C;
+    } else {
+        gr[TARGET_REG_R0] = tswap32(env->regs[0]);
+    }
+
+    gr[TARGET_REG_R1] = tswap32(env->regs[1]);
+    gr[TARGET_REG_R2] = tswap32(env->regs[2]);
+    gr[TARGET_REG_R3] = tswap32(env->regs[3]);
+    gr[TARGET_REG_R4] = tswap32(env->regs[4]);
+    gr[TARGET_REG_R5] = tswap32(env->regs[5]);
+    gr[TARGET_REG_R6] = tswap32(env->regs[6]);
+    gr[TARGET_REG_R7] = tswap32(env->regs[7]);
+    gr[TARGET_REG_R8] = tswap32(env->regs[8]);
+    gr[TARGET_REG_R9] = tswap32(env->regs[9]);
+    gr[TARGET_REG_R10] = tswap32(env->regs[10]);
+    gr[TARGET_REG_R11] = tswap32(env->regs[11]);
+    gr[TARGET_REG_R12] = tswap32(env->regs[12]);
+
+    gr[TARGET_REG_SP] = tswap32(env->regs[13]);
+    gr[TARGET_REG_LR] = tswap32(env->regs[14]);
+    gr[TARGET_REG_PC] = tswap32(env->regs[15]);
+
+    if (mcp->mc_vfp_size != 0 && mcp->mc_vfp_ptr != NULL) {
+        /* see get_vfpcontext in sys/arm/arm/exec_machdep.c */
+        target_mcontext_vfp_t *vfp = (target_mcontext_vfp_t *)mcp->mc_vfp_ptr;
+        for (int i = 0; i < 32; i++) {
+            vfp->mcv_reg[i] = tswap64(*aa32_vfp_dreg(env, i));
+        }
+        vfp->mcv_fpscr = tswap32(vfp_get_fpscr(env));
+    }
+    return err;
+}
